用js改变 form的action不就可以了

解决方案 »

  1.   

    <form name=thisform method=post>
    <input type=button value=a onclick="formSub('a')">
    <input type=button value=b onclick="formSub('b')">
    </form>
    <script>
    function formSub(s)
    {
      if( s == 'a' ){
          document.thisform.action = 'a.php'
      }
      if( s == 'b' ){
          document.thisform.action = 'b.php'
      }
      document.thisform.submit()
    }
    </script>
      

  2.   

    <input type='submit' value="按钮1" onClick="form.action='a.php'" ;form.submit()> 
    <input type='submit' value="按钮2" onClick="form.action='b.php'" ;form.submit()>